The big question tends to be what you are fielding - but the quick answer for Basilisks is 'long range anti-tank' as that will allow you to start knocking at them Turn 1 pretty much no matter where they deploy.

DSing in anti-mech stuff can potentially be good, especially since we can do it without scattering and Basilisks have nice flimsy side and rear armor - though I would usually feel that there would likely be more vital targets than Basilisks at that stage.

Honestly, just aggressively moving up the board and getting in under their range is a pretty amazing way to nerf them too. I love Basilisks, but I tend to love them in Apoc, not in standard 40k.

If he is mech heavy and leaves them almost undefended a good (read as fun) tactic would be 5 scourges 4 blaster and an archon with a blaster and wwp. This is dangerous but if hes one of those AM players who think you cant get to his artillery you can prove him wrong. Similarly the same build but with trueborn in a raider instead of scourges will net you one more S8 AP2 shot and somthing to eat fire for your archon and the trueborn.

These options are not necessarily cheap points wise but can work wonders on an unsuspecting enemy.

250 points for scourges and archon

285 points for archon and trueborn in a DL raider

Im a fan of my anti-mech landing where i need it Hence the unnecessary addition of the archon and wwp, But find what works for you. Our army has a handful of options for anti-mech you just have to find the one that works with what you field

unless you're super-keen on the looks of the voidraven, leave it on the shelf & instead go for a razorwing jetfighter. Better rules, cheaper implementation, smaller target in game.

Basilisks really aren't that scary, if you're in a raider, jink to gain a 4+/3+ save against their firepower, boost forwards aggressively towards them, and shoot any of our limited AT at them. Reavers w/ bladevane impact hits are quite effective as well as the basilisk is side/rear AV10.
